Changing the Paper Size in the Wide Large Capacity Tray

Important

  1. Check that paper in the paper tray is not being used, and then pull the tray carefully out until it stops.

    Wide LCT illustration

  2. Remove paper if loaded.

  3. Release the end fence.

    Wide LCT illustration

  4. Loosen the screws holding the side fences in position.

    Wide LCT illustration

  5. Load paper by aligning the paper with the left side of the paper tray.

    Place paper with print side up.

    Load a stack of paper about 5 hyphen 10 mm (0.2 hyphen 0.4 inches) high.

    Make sure the paper rest on top of the supporting plates on both sides.

    Wide LCT illustration

    1. Supporting plates

  6. Take the grip of the side fences with your fingers, and adjust the side fences to the paper size.

    Wide LCT illustration

  7. Set the paper flush against the protrusions in the bottom of the inner side fence.

  8. Secure the side fences by carefully tightening the screws.

    Wide LCT illustration

  9. Load additional sheets, if necessary.

    Do not stack paper over the limit mark.

    Wide LCT illustration

  10. Tightly fit the end fence to the loaded paper, and then re-lock the end fence again.

    Make sure there are no gaps between the paper and end fence.

    Wide LCT illustration

  11. Carefully slide the paper tray fully in.

  12. Check the paper size on the display.
